A resolution expressing the sense of the House of Representatives that the United States could not remain indifferent to any internal repression or external aggression against the people of Poland and that such developments would have serious consequences for East-West relations.
1981-07-30: Resolution Agreed to in House by Yea-Nay Vote: 410 - 1 (Record Vote No: 179).
